Definition and Explanation

Prostitution is a crime that can involve offering or engaging in sexual activity for a fee. Solicitation refers to seeking such activity through direct communication or advertising. Both offenses may carry penalties and court requirements depending on the specific conduct and location. Understanding these elements helps a defendant respond appropriately, gather supporting information, and prepare a coherent defense. Legal counsel works to examine evidence, challenge improper procedures, and preserve fundamental rights during all stages of the case.

Arraignment

Arraignment is the court event where charges are formally read, pleas are entered, and bail decisions are made. The process sets the stage for the defense strategy and future court dates. Understanding the arraignment helps a client prepare a coherent plea and gather necessary documents. An attorney explains options, negotiates with the prosecutor when suitable, and ensures rights are protected during this initial stage in Lynwood courts.

What should I do immediately after an arrest for prostitution or solicitation?

First contact an attorney to review the charges and your rights. Do not speak with law enforcement without counsel present, as statements can be used later. An attorney can explain options and help plan next steps.\n\nSecond, gather any documents, identify witnesses, and write down timelines to assist your defense. A careful start helps build a strong foundation for the case and improves communication with the defense team.
